How to Tell When Your Deck Needs Refinishing
When your deck begins to show evidence of deterioration, it's crucial to identify the signals that suggest it's time for refinishing. You'll notice the deck stain becoming dull, which shows the protective sealant is breaking down. Inspect the wood grain—if it feels rough or you observe fissures, the surface is no longer effectively protected from moisture. Moisture penetration is a clear warning sign; if water gets absorbed rather than beading up, your deck's finish has degraded. Gray discoloration, mold, or mildew show UV and moisture damage to the wood fibers. Picking the Ideal Wood Finish for Sonoma County's Climate
Although Sonoma County enjoys warm days and cool winter weather, these changing climate factors demand careful choice of deck stains and finishes. It's essential to find a deck stain solution that offers both UV protection and water resistance. Semi-transparent stains typically balance wood grain visibility with weatherproofing, while solid stains offer optimal color retention and shield. Select oil-based products for better penetration in older wood, or water-based alternatives for quick drying and environmentally friendly cleanup.
When applying finishing techniques, focus on even application and proper drying times to stop peeling or bubbling. Use high-quality tools or spray systems to maintain consistent coverage. Make sure to adhere to manufacturer recommendations for coating and curing, as incorrect implementation can compromise protection. With the proper finish and precise finishing techniques, your deck will endure Sonoma County's unique climate.

Routine Cleaning Plan
Regular maintenance serves as the core of a long-lasting deck, and establishing a routine cleaning schedule makes certain your deck remains structurally sound and visually appealing. Commence by taking away garden furniture and patio lighting before brushing to remove debris, as trapped dirt and leaves can hasten surface deterioration. Utilize a deck-specific cleaner and a soft-bristle brush to tackle mold, mildew, and stains without harming the wood. Focus on areas beneath garden furniture, where moisture tends to accumulate. Wash completely with a garden hose, steering clear of power washers that may wear down the wood fibers. Schedule deep cleans at least twice a year, and conduct spot cleaning as needed after gatherings. Consistent cleaning decreases wear, inhibits discoloration, and lengthens your deck's service life substantially.
Proper Sealing Practices
Once your deck is properly cleaned, installing a sealant provides a crucial barrier against moisture damage, UV rays, and everyday wear. For the best results, select a top-grade sealant specifically designed for exterior wooden surfaces. Make sure the deck is fully dry before applying sealant, as residual water can impact proper adhesion and lead to uneven coverage. Use a brush or roller to blend the sealant into the wood grain, paying special attention to joints and ends where water might seep in. Sealing not only protects your deck, but further brings out the lumber's inherent appearance. Add a fresh coat every one to three years, according to traffic and sun exposure, to maintain optimal protection and keep your deck looking vibrant.
Avoiding Water Damage
While a quality sealant establishes the basis of deck protection, consistent maintenance has a vital role in stopping moisture damage. You must routinely inspect your deck for indicators of water intrusion, including warping, discoloration, or soft spots. Resolve any drainage concerns by ensuring gaps between boards stay clear and that water flows away from the structure. Put on deck sealing products every 1 to 3 years, according to your deck's exposure and the manufacturer's recommendations. Wash the surface periodically to eliminate mildew and debris, which could trap moisture. Avoid letting leaves or planters to sit directly on the wood, as this could affect moisture control. By remaining proactive, you'll extend your deck's lifespan and preserve its structural integrity against Sonoma County's unique climate challenges.

What's the Typical Timeline for a Complete Deck Refinishing Project?
When you undertake a deck refinishing project, expect the project timeline to take two to five days, according to your deck's size and condition. You'll need the first day or two on cleaning, sanding, and readying the surface. After adding the finish, provide another one to three days for the curing process. If you desire maximum durability and appearance, don't rush—each step demands time to guarantee quality, long-lasting results.

What's the Ideal Season for Deck Refinishing in Sonoma County?
The optimal timing for deck refinishing depends on seasonal conditions to ensure success. In Sonoma County, the timeframe spanning late spring through early fall provides ideal weather conditions—where moderate temperatures and low humidity enable finishes to set properly. Steer clear of periods of rain or very hot weather, as wetness and rapid drying may impact the end result. If you pick a dry, moderate time period, you can achieve lasting protection and a professional, smooth look for your deck restoration.
